As an RN Charge Nurse, you will provide direct nursing care to residents and supervise the day-to-day nursing activities performed by the nursing assistants to ensure that the highest degree of quality care is maintained at all times. You are responsible and accountable for carrying out your assigned duties and reporting directly to the Nursing Supervisor.

Experience & Education:

Must possess, as a minimum, a Nursing Degree from an accredited school of nursing or college.

A minimum of one (1) year experience in a hospital, long-term care facility, or other health care facility is preferable.

Must possess a current, unencumbered license to practice as a Registered Nurse.

Must be CPR certified.

Participate in mandatory in-service training as requested.

Duties & Responsibilities:

Ensures that all residents receive the highest quality of care in a caring and compassionate atmosphere, while promoting positive resident, family, and employee relations.

Provides oversight of CNA performance; ensures that CNAs are performing their assignments/duties in accordance with policies and procedures and standards of practice.

Reviews resident records daily to assure accuracy and completeness.

Maintains accurate awareness of residents on alert list.

Documents comprehensive and complete nursing notes.

Visits each resident daily to evaluate resident needs.

Transcribes and follows physician’s orders promptly and accurately. Renders and/or assists with completing nursing care, treatments, medication administration, dressings, and other physician orders as applicable.

Communicates relevant clinical information to CNAs, Nursing Supervisor & oncoming shift.

Maintains and oversees current Resident Care Plans and CNA Care Cards on all residents under his/her care. Participates in resident care plan meetings.

Maintains an accurate and safe control of all drugs for which he/she is responsible.

Participates in the on-call program for the nursing department as directed by the DNS.

Ensures that CNAs follow established Infection Control Procedures to prevent the spreading of infection.

Completes Accidents and Incidents reports (Reportable events), ensuring that all appropriate notifications, documentation, investigation, reporting, and interventions are complete.

Completes yearly performance evaluations of CNAs as directed by the DNS.

Participates in surveys and inspections by government agencies and implements plans of correction for deficiencies as directed by the DNS.

Monitors and reviews all at-risk residents (I+O’s, weights, restraints, falls, wounds, etc.). Oversees CWC program and ambulation programs as directed. Participates in committees and meetings. Provides input for Quality Improvement in the Nursing department.

Assists Director of Nurses with disciplinary process when assigned.

Other duties deemed appropriate and assigned by your supervisor.

Specific Requirements:

Must be able to read, write, speak, and understand the English language.

Must possess the ability to make independent decisions when circumstances warrant such actions.

Must possess the ability to deal tactfully with personnel, residents, family members, visitors, government agencies/personnel, and the general public.

Must be knowledgeable of nursing and medical practices and procedures, as well as laws, regulations, and guidelines that pertain to long-term care.

Must possess accurate and comprehensive assessment skills.

Must have knowledge of restorative nursing rehabilitation policies and utilize appropriately.

Must have patience, tact, a cheerful disposition, and enthusiasm, as well as the willingness to handle difficult residents.

Must be able to communicate effectively to appropriate personnel regarding emergency situations.
